The Dornan family from Belfast jet off with Joe and Suzanne to the popular resort of Benalmadena on the Costa del Sol in southern Spain.

Benalmadena contains all the traditional activities and attractions one would expect from a busy resort on the Sunshine Coast, but there is another side to the place - in the picturesque streets and white walled buildings of the old quarter. The best views of the town and the long, sun-kissed coastline are from the Telecabina cable car and Suzanne and Dawn do some serious shopping and celebrity spotting at the exclusive yachting resort of Puerto Banus, a playground of the rich and famous.

Map of the Costa del SolFlying time: The flight to Malaga in Southern Spain takes about 2 hours ad 40 minutes
Best time to visit:
There is good weather virtually all year round, but during the high summer months temperatures can get very high.
Currency: Euro
Language: Spanish
Time Difference: GMT = 1 hour ahead

Extra Info: The coast roads in Costa del Sol are very busy. The road from Malaga to Marbella is one of the busiest in Europe during the summer, so you should bear this in mind if you’re thinking of hiring a car. Although car hire is quite reasonable, driving here can be a bit daunting. Apart from the traffic, the town roads are narrow and everyone travels at high speed so you might want to consider using the bus service which is cheap and an easy way to get around.
The beach in BenalmadenaBest Beaches: Normally on Ulster Fly we give our guide to The Top 5 Beaches but here in Benalmadena the coastline stretches on for miles, with neighbouring beaches in Torremolinos in one direction and Fuengirola in the other. Each beach offers similar attractions: shallow waters, golden sands, sun loungers, water-sports and they are close to all the amenities. So basically your top beach is the one nearest your accommodation.
